简单的SQL入门

一,简介

  1,  一个数据库包含一个或多个表,表包含带有数据的记录(行)

  2,  SQL对大小写不敏感,语句的分号看具体情况

二,语法

  1,  数据操作语言:DML

    a)         SELECT:从数据库获取数据

    b)         UPDATE:更新数据库表中的数据

    c)         DELETE:从数据库中删除数据

    d)         INSERT INTO:向数据表中插入数据

  2,  数据定义语言:DDL

    a)         CREATE DATABASE:创建新的数据库

    b)         ALTER DATABASE:修改数据库

    c)         CREATE TABLE:创建新的数据表

    d)         ALTER TABLE:修改数据表

    e)         DROP TABLE:删除数据表

    f)          CREATE INDEX:创建索引

    g)         DROP INDEX:删除索引

三,SELECT

  1,  SELECT 列名称 FROM 表名称

  2,  SELECT * FROM 表名称

四,DISTINCT

  1,  选取列中唯一的数据

  2,  SELECT DISTINCT 列名称 FROM 表名称

五,WHERE

  1,  有条件的选取

  2,  SELECT 列名称 FROM 表名称 WHERE 列名 操作符 值

    a)         =(等于)  <>(不等于)  >(大于)  <(小于)  >=  <=  BETWEEN(某个范围内) LIKE(搜索某种模式)

  3,  引号的使用,值为文本需要使用引号,为数字值,不需要引号

六,AND和OR

  1,  在WHERE语句中把多个条件连接起来

七,ORDER BY

  1,  根据指定的列对结果集进行排序(默认升序),DESC为降序,ASC为升序

  2,  SELECT 列名 FROM 表名 ORDER BY 列名 (DESC OR ASC)

八,INSERT INTO

  1,  INSERT INTO 表名 VALUES (值1,值2,值3…)

  2,  INSERT INTO 表名 (列1,列2,…) VALUES (值1,值2,….)

九,UPDATE

  1,  UPDATE 表名 SET 列名 = 新值 WHERE 列名 = 指定值

  2,  设置多个列,用逗号隔开

十,DELETE

  1,  DELETE * FROM 表名

  2,  DELETE FROM 表名 WHERE 列名 = 指定值,

一些简单的SQL语句的更多相关文章

  1. [20190328]简单探究sql语句相关mutexes.txt

    [20190328]简单探究sql语句相关mutexes.txt --//摘要:http://www.askmaclean.com/archives/understanding-oracle-mute ...

  2. 四种简单的sql语句(增删改查语句)

    四种简单的sql语句(增删改查语句) 一.插入语句 insert into [table] ([column],[column],[column]) values(?,?,?) 二.删除语句 dele ...

  3. tp5 r3 一个简单的SQL语句调试实例

    tp5 r3 一个简单的SQL语句调试实例先看效果核心代码 public function index() { if (IS_AJAX && session("uid&quo ...

  4. UI:简单的SQL语句

    一.SQL语句如果要在程序运行过程中操作数据库中的数据,那得先学会使用SQL语句1.什么是SQLSQL(structured query language):结构化查询语言SQL是一种对关系型数据库中 ...

  5. 数据库学习之简单的SQL语句

    1.数据库的结构 1.1数据库 不同数据库叫做Catalog(在有的 DBMS 中也称为 Database,即数据库) .採用多 Catalog 以后能够给我们带 来例如以下优点: 便于对各个 Cat ...

  6. 简单的SQL语句

    说明:SQL语句大小写都可以,执行一句时,后面可不加分号,如果同时执行两句,就必须加分号,不然会报错. --+空格  是SQL的注释 表格名为users,里面有name和age属性 一.增 inser ...

  7. JDBC之java数据库的连接与简单的sql语句执行

    import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sq ...

  8. 用jdbc连接数据库并简单执行SQL语句

    一:版本一.这种存在一个问题就是每执行一次操作都会创建一次Connection链接和且释放一次链接 1:创建pojo对象(OR映射,一个pojo类对应一张数据库表)   package com.yin ...

  9. 比Excel还简单的SQL语句查询

    大家好,我是jacky朱元禄,很高兴继续跟大家分享<MySQL数据分析实战>系列课程,前面的课程jacky分享了数据层面增删改查中的增删改,下面的课程我们要说增删改查的这个查,jacky说 ...

随机推荐

  1. oracle_fdw的安装和使用

    1.下载instant oracle client 下载网址:https://www.oracle.com/technetwork/topics/linuxx86-64soft-092277.html ...

  2. 使用 gRPC-UI 调试.NET 5的gPRC服务

    在上一篇文章中,我介绍了gRPCurl一个命令行工具,该工具可用于测试gRPC服务的端点,在本文中,我将向您介绍 gRPC-ui, 它可以作为Web工具使用,有点像Postman,但用于gRPC AP ...

  3. Docker 建站小记

    一,前言 Docker 建站小记,我使用了四个镜像来搭建:nginx,certbot,mysql,gradle.欢迎访问:https://www.zzk0.top 这个网页是从 github 上找的个 ...

  4. 7行代码解决P1441砝码称重(附优化过程)

    先贴上最终代码感受一下: #include <bits/stdc++.h> using namespace std; int i, N, M, wi[21], res = 0; int m ...

  5. jQ实现图片无缝轮播

    在铺页面的过程中,总是会遇到轮播图需要处理,一般我是会用swiper来制作,但总会有哪个几个个例需要我自己来写功能,这里制作了一个jq用来实现图片无缝轮播的dome,分享给大家ヽ( ̄▽ ̄)ノ. dom ...

  6. 干货 | 质量保障新手段,携程回归测试平台实践 原创 Sedro 携程技术 2021-01-21

    干货 | 质量保障新手段,携程回归测试平台实践 原创 Sedro 携程技术 2021-01-21

  7. maven project builder fails when running on jdk>9

    java.lang.NoClassDefFoundError: Could not initialize class org.codehaus.plexus.archiver.jar.JarArchi ...

  8. Shell 简单入门教程

    大数据开发岗为什么要学习Shell呢?1)需要看懂大数据运维岗人员编写的Shell程序.2)偶尔会编写一些简单Shell程序来管理集群.提高开发效率 艺多不压身 Shell是一个命令行解释器,它接受应 ...

  9. Java获取类路径的方式

    Java环境中,如何获取当前类的路径.如何获取项目根路径等: @Test public void showURL() throws IOException { // 第一种:获取类加载的根路径 Fil ...

  10. 并发编程(Process对象的join方法)(

    一. Process对象的join方法 在主进程运行过程中如果想并发地执行其他的任务,我们可以开启子进程,此时主进程的任务与子进程的任务分两种情况 情况一:在主进程的任务与子进程的任务彼此独立的情况下 ...